Nick Bosa has agreed to a five-year, $170 million extension with the San Francisco 49ers, including $122.5 million guaranteed, by a wide margin. It will make him the highest-paid defensive player in history.

$34m/year annual average. That's a big jump over Aaron Donald's $31.67m/year. No discounts on offer here.

No wonder the negotiations took so long, that was probably a brutal deal to structure and make work with the team's 2024 cap. Looking forward to the contract details.
